[ TESTING ]
La actividad de prueba de sistemas se caracteriza por su complejidad en entornos, donde se trata con varias capas de equipos no homogéneos, en los cuales una transacción recorre los diferentes ambientes on-line y batch, expandiendo sus efectos a través de muchos programas y archivos. La organización compartida de los recursos, conlleva a que cada especialista desconozca, a menudo, las consecuencias que sus decisiones pueden tener en el resto del sistema.
Ciclo de vida de las pruebas
1. Planeamiento de las pruebas
Proceso de definir un proyecto de pruebas para que pueda ser correctamente medido y controlado.
2. Diseño de la prueba
Proceso de definir y delimitar las pruebas en términos de:
- Casos de prueba
- Procedimientos de prueba
- Métodos de verificación
- Scripts de la prueba
3. Desarrollo de la prueba
Proceso de implementar los procedimientos de prueba.
4. Ejecución de la prueba
- Ejecutar los procedimientos y casos de prueba.
- Reproducir los scripts de prueba.
- Realizar pruebas manuales.
5. Evaluación de las pruebas
Proceso de analizar los resultados de una prueba y determinar si los criterios de prueba se satisfacen o no.
6. Seguimiento del defecto
Proceso de registrar los incidentes de las pruebas o los problemas del usuario, investigándolos y creando una estructura que permita solucionarlos.
arriba